Everest Hiking

Everest HikingThe Mount Everest region is one of the most popular trekking and hiking areas in Nepal - tinged with the romance of being so close to the highest mountain in the world. The route lies in the highest wildlife reserve in the World, The Sagarmatha National park is rich with flora and fauna. But the existence of the Yeti remains a mystery. This hiking offers an enduring experience of natural beauty, geological magnificence with the breathtaking views of the world highest mountain along with the worlds other three highest mountains.

We follow the Dudh Koshi the "milk river" north through terraced hillsides and small villages to join the main Everest hiking trail below Lukla. The route passes through Lush valleys with abundant flora and fauna, spectacular forests of blooming rhododendron in March April, blue pine and fir. Past friendly Sherpa villages and Buddhist monasteries through the famous Sherpa village of Namche Bazaar , Tengboche Buddhist Monastery, Khunde Khumjung. And far above the tree line towards the earth’s highest mountains. on your walking you will be rewarded with breath taking views of Everest 8848m, Cho Oyu 8152m, Lhotse 8516m, Thamserku (6506m), Makalu 8463m and Ama Dablam 6456m, Kantega and may more mountains.

Itinerary for Everest Hiking

Day 01: Meet at Kathmandu Airport and transfer to hotel

Day 02:Sight-seeing of Kathmandu: Full day’s sightseeing in Kathmandu valley includes the Hindu temple complex at Pashupatinath (a UNESCO World Heritage Site) & the biggest Buddhist Stupa at Boudhanath. Also visit Monkey Temple the Swyambhunath (2000 years old temple) and visit Patan city of fine arts. Return to the hotel.

Day 3:Flight from KTM – Lukla. Trek to Phakding (2,652m). After having a 35 minutes flight to lulkla you start your trek and following a gentle climb up the mountain side on the left bank of the Dudh Koshi River. One the way you will have a view of Kusum Kangaru, Mt Kwondge and you will pass a few tea houses and Mani walls. Overnight in Phakding.

Day 04:

Phakding to Namche (3,440m) - Beginning with a slight climb to Jhorsalle, the trail passes a waterfall. All day, we pass villages interspersed with magnificent forest- rhododendron, magniolia trees and giant firs. And on the way to walking you will be rewarded (weather permitting) your first glimpse of Kusum Kanggru (6369m) Thamserku (6608m) Everest (8848m) and Nuptse (7879 m). A steep climb up to the beautiful village of Namche Bazaar (3440m).

Day 05:Acclimatization day in Namche. Acclimatization is most important before proceeding to a higher elevation. It is therefore recommended that you take a short day’s hike to Thame, Khunde or Khumjung or relax and explore the Sherpa culture of Namche.

Day 06: Namche to Tengboche (3,867m): after walking one hour you arrive in phungithanga from there the trail climbs through forests where you can spot musk deer. Tengboche sits on a saddle at 3870m in a clearing surrounded by dwarf fires and rododendroms. Kwongde (6187m) Tawache(6542m) Everest (8848m) Nuptse (7855m) Lhotse (8618m) Amadablam (6856m) Thamserku (6608m) provide and inspiring panorama of Himalayan giants. We visit the Bhuddist Monastry at Tengboche, the largest in Khumbu region.

Day 07:Tengboche to Khumjung Village (3,789m) we walk down to the river then start hiking up to Khumjung village. Many trekkers enjoy like this Khumjung village as there is a very beautiful community of Sherpas.

Day 08: Khumjung to Monjo (2,835m) you can have a pleasant walk via the Everest View Hotel and the Shyangboche airstrip before dropping into Namche, a color full center of Sherpa community, After having a lunch in Namche you descend steeply and then walk along the river bank back to Jorsalle where you leave the national park before continuing on to Monjo for overnight stay. After that continue trek down to Phakding.

Day 09:Monjo to Lukla (2880m) it is a beautiful and easy walk through blue pine and rhododendron forest, back-dropped with views of Kusum Kangaru Last day of the trek in a bustling town enjoy dinner with your Trekking crew.

Day 10: Flight from Lukla to KTM, transfer to hotel

Day 11:Kathmandu free day, evening culture show with Nepali dinner, hotel

Day 12:Final departure, transfer to airport
